Cheyenne celebrated Veterans Day on Friday, November 7, with a special reception for veterans and their families, followed by an inspiring assembly with our 8th-grade class.
We were honored to welcome Senator Adam Pugh as our guest speaker. Senator Pugh served nearly eight years in the U.S. Air Force as an Electronic Combat Officer, logging over 2,000 flight hours aboard the E-3 AWACS and coordinating missions across Iraq, the Balkans, Asia, and Eastern Europe.
Students and staff were deeply moved to meet veterans who served in WWII, the Korean War, the Vietnam War, Operation Desert Storm, and Operation Iraqi Freedom.
💙 Thank you to all who have served our country — your courage and sacrifice inspire us every day.

This week, Cheyenne 8th graders took part in meaningful lessons about the Oklahoma City Murrah Building bombing of April 19, 1995. Through activities like Leaving a Legacy, The Survivor Tree, Remembering the Victims , and The Investigation, students explored themes of resilience, hope, and remembrance.
The week concluded with a visit to the Oklahoma City National Memorial & Museum, where students experienced the story of that day and its lasting impact on our state and nation. 💛

Clinics and auditions are coming up for the All-Edmond Winter Guard! Winter Guard is a competitive indoor activity that runs through the spring semester and teaches dance and flag skills. Come compete with students from across the entire Edmond district as we seek to defend our state championship JV title from last year. This activity is open for all 7th and 8th grade students. No prior experience is needed.
Clinics are Monday and Tuesday, November 10th and 11th and the audition is Friday, November 14th.
Clinics and auditions are at the Edmond Memorial Band Room. Band teachers can answer general questions. Please contact kathryn.hellstern@edmondschools.net for specific questions.
